Bonjour;
j'ai une problème pour faire la connexion à la base entre php et oracle 10g Express Edition , j'aimerai avoir quels sont les étapes pour faire ça.
j'attends votre répense.
Bonjour;
j'ai une problème pour faire la connexion à la base entre php et oracle 10g Express Edition , j'aimerai avoir quels sont les étapes pour faire ça.
j'attends votre répense.
C'est quoi votre problème au juste ?
Veuillez faire une description.
EDIT : La première recherche sur google m'envoi dans un bon lien (Documentation PHP)
Il parle de OCILOGON..
Bonjour,
utilise la classe pdo.
active les extensions :
extension=php_pdo.dll pour la classe pdo
extension=php_pdo_oci.dll (pour oracle)
création objet pdo :
PDO::__construct ( string dsn [, string username [, string password [, array driver_options]]] )Liste de paramètres :
dsn : source de données (localisation).En général :
Nom_de_driver_PDO:chaîne_connection_ou_alias (tnsnames)
username
Le nom d'utilisateur pour la chaîne DSN. Ce paramètre est optionnel pour quelques drivers PDO.
password
Le mot de passe pour la chaîne DSN. Ce paramètre est optionnel pour quelques drivers PDO.
driver_options
Un tableau clé=>valeur contenant les options de connexion spécifiques au driver
cordialement
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13 $connect_str = "oci:dbname=xe"; $connect_user = "toto"; $connect_pass = "toto"; try { $dboracle = new PDO($connect_str, $connect_user, $connect_pass); echo "connecté à Oracle"; } catch (PDOException $e) { echo "Echec de la connexion" .$e->getMessage(); exit(); }
Partager